15:59Around 11pm, Evansville police officers were dispatched for a possible kidnapping and murder.
16:05An adult female victim was still on scene and told officers that she went to the residence
16:09residents to visit with Heidi Carter. She saw a dead body and ran out of the home to get help.
16:15Officers located 36-year-old Heidi Carter outside of the home near a vehicle.
16:22What's in your pants? Is there a gun in your pants?
16:27Don't move.
16:39Yep. Quit moving.
16:49Yeah, it's loaded.
16:51It's not my gun.
16:56Don't move.
16:57A male rushed out of the front door in an aggressive manner and several officers fired at
17:12the suspect to stop the perceived threat. The suspect was pronounced dead on scene. Once
17:17officers cleared the home, officers located an adult female victim who had been tied up,
17:23shackled, and had visible injuries. Another individual was located inside the residence,
17:29but unfortunately was deceased and beyond help. He had been restrained, duct-taped, beaten,
17:36and strangled. The manner of death will be released by the Vandenberg County Coroner's Office at a later
17:41time.

24:12Heidi Carter was arrested and booked to the following charges.
24:16Murder, rape, two counts of felony, criminal confinement,
24:21assisting a criminal, carrying a handgun without a license,
24:24and abuse of a corpse.
